Lift AfCON Trophy, Get $1.5m Reward – Rabiu Promises S’Eagles
[The Whistler - Nigeria] - 10/01/2026
The Chairman and Founder of BUA Group, Abdul Samad Rabiu, has promised to reward Super Eagles players with $1.5m if they emerge champions of the 2025 Nations Cup. He also promised the team $500,000 if they win the semi-final against Morocco, with an additional $50,000 for every goal scored. (…)
